Abstract
The switchback device has two switchback portions for inverting the conveying path of paper-like materials and a detour conveying path. The switchback portions receive paper-like materials in the nip between the switchback rollers and the pinch rollers, clamp the paper-like materials, decelerate, stop, and accelerate them in the opposite direction in a clamping state, thereby switch back the paper-like materials. The stopping time of paper-like materials in the switchback portions is changed according to the length of the paper-like materials in the conveying direction.
